The high school graduation rate in the region is above the state average, and about 27 percent of the population is under 18 years of age.The northernmost area of Texas is called the Panhandle. It is straight and narrow like the handle of a pan with the broader area of the state below it, like the bottom of a pan. This region has mostly flat, grassy land or plains. These plains are part of the same flat grassland that extends from the Great Plains of the Central United States.

The High Plains region is mostly rural with two large urban areas, offering an unusually diverse economy. Its 41 counties have many unique economic conditions and challenges. Potter and Lubbock counties, with the cities of Amarillo and Lubbock, are the region's economic centers.High Plains Trailers, Commerce City, Colorado. 193 likes · 10 were here. The 30 most ...The High Plains The Texas Great Plains includes two subregions: the High Plains and the Edwards Plateau. The High Plains subregion covers most of the Texas Panhandle. The land of the High Plains is higher than the Central Plains region. A hard bed of rock below the soil known as the Caprock is another noticeable physical feature in the area.The Panhandle Plains are in the northwestern corner of Texas where you can find the second largest canyon in the U.S., Palo Duro Canyon . Amarillo is one of the largest cities in the region with ranching and farming as the main industries. Great Plains, vast high plateau of semiarid grassland The Ogallala Aquifer is the largest aquifer in the United States and is a major aquifer of Texas underlying much of the High Plains region. The aquifer consists of sand, gravel, clay, and silt and has a maximum thickness of 800 feet. Freshwater saturated thickness averages 95 feet. The Coastal Plains region includes about one-third of Texas. It extends east and south from the Balcones Escarpment to the Gulf of Mexico. Most of Texas’s large cities are in the Coastal Plains. As a result, the Coastal Plains region is home to more people than any other part of Texas. About two out of every three Texans live in the Coastal ...
